How does the air conditioning work on Land Rover Discovery?

The air conditioning of your Land Rover Discovery operates in a very comparable way to that of your family fridge, in fact, it works with a compressor and refrigerant gas system which, depending on its condition (liquid or gas) will produce cold. This system operates in a closed circuit. Here are the main components that will ensure that the air conditioning of your Land Rover Discovery functions effectively:

  • The compressor: It is the key element of your air conditioning unit, it manages the pressure in your circuit and it will control the circulation of fluids in the circuit.
  • The condenser: this small coil has as main goal, like a radiator, to allow the gas to decrease in temperature and come back to a liquid condition (55 degrees).
  • The air blower and the evaporator: The heating blower will subject the pressurized liquid to a high temperature which will make it transform into gas and during this changeover will produce cold which will be sent into the passenger compartment by the evaporator.

In fact, this device operates in a closed circuit, and by causing variations in temperature and pressure, the refrigerant gas will be allowed to modify state, leading to the production of heat or cold. You now know how the air conditioning of your Land Rover Discovery works.

Some advices on how to use the air-conditioning of your Land Rover Discovery

To conclude, last section of our content, now that you understand how to turn on the air conditioning on your Land Rover Discovery, we will see some practical suggestions to improve the usage of your air conditioning and preserve it:

    • When you arrive in your Land Rover Discovery which has been left in the sun, first open your windows at the same time as the air conditioning to gets rid of the excess of hot air before closing them again to let your air conditioning operate.
    • In the winter, you can use your air conditioner to remove the mist from the tiles, due to its air dehumidifier, it will be more powerful than your heating system.
    • Turn off the air conditioning in your Land Rover Discovery 5 minutes before turning off the engine to keep your air conditioning compressor and avoid moisture smells in the passenger compartment.   • Switch on the air conditioning of your Land Rover Discovery often, even in winter, to keep it working effectively.
  • Don’t set your air conditioning to a temperature too different from the outside temperature or you may get sick. Also, don’t project the airflow straight onto your face, but rather onto your arms or chest.
